Opportunity description

The United Nations is offering a full-time job as a Head Procurement Section Officer to join the team in Amman, Jordan. 

Duties & responsibilities

  1. Serves as a senior procurement and contracting expert with responsibility for the procurement of a wide variety of supplies and services associated with complex (technically and legally) contracts and procurement activities. Plans, develops and manages the various procurement and contractual aspects of projects of diverse services and commodities (e.g. medicines, health related equipment, food commodities, construction and maintenance services, insurance services, information technology, vehicles, etc.).
  2. Establishes approaches for negotiation of contracts and conducts or coordinates all phases of negotiations with all concerned parties, including the negotiation of disputes arising from contracts. Develops new strategic approaches to contracts as well as new methods for their application based on market research and best practices. Formulates strategies and designs innovative solutions to resolve issues/conflicts arising from complex procurement projects.
  3. Develops and prepares complex contracts, issues tender invitations, evaluates responses to tender and makes recommendations for finalization of purchases and award of contracts; signs procurement orders up to the authorized limit and, in case the amount exceeds the authorized signature authority, prepares submissions to the Contracts Committee for review and subsequent approval by the authorized official.
  4. Provides technical advice on procurement activities to headquarters and fields staff to ensure efficient use of resources throughout the phases of the procurement cycle. Organizes internal procurement training and provides technical direction and guidance to more junior Procurement staff.
  5. Monitors adherence to contractual agreements, recommends amendments and extensions of contracts, and advises concerned stakeholders on their contractual rights and obligations in consultation with the department of legal affairs.
  6. Prepares a variety of complex procurement-related documents, correspondences and reports to internal and external stakeholders, including responses to audit observations; analyzes the existing procurement practices and procedures and contributes to the development of institutional procurement policies and procedures.
  7. Controls and oversees the maintenance of contract management documentation, information and records, contracts, tenders and bids, suppliers and claims information ensuring their accuracy and confidentiality at all times.

Eligibility criteria

  1. Advanced university degree (Master's degree or equivalent) from an accredited educational institution in business administration, public administration, supply chain, law or a related field.
  2. A minimum of eight years of progressively responsible relevant experience in procurement, contract management, supply chain or administration in the public or private sector.
  3. At least five years should be directly related to first-hand procurement preferably at the international level.
  4. A minimum of two continuous years of relevant international experience outside UNRWA, and outside the country(s) of which the candidate is a national or holds citizenship, a passport or a national identity number.
  5. Procurement experience in the provision of medicines and/or food commodities and/or IT equipment and services and/or in construction projects.
  6. Knowledge of and skills in use of procurement related functions in ERP and other procurement related information management systems.
  7. Experience in providing support services to Field Offices under humanitarian, development, or conflict context (Desirable).
  8. Experience in conducting procurement at the international level for an intergovernmental organization, governmental organization, or a large multi-national organization (Desirable).
  9. Excellent command of written and spoken English.

About the UN:

The United Nations (UN), was established in 1945, is an intergovernmental organization responsible for maintaining international peace and security, developing friendly relations among nations, achieving international cooperation, and being a center for harmonizing the actions of nations. It is the largest, most familiar, most internationally represented and most powerful intergovernmental organization in the world.
